Technical field
The utility model relates to automatic vehicle equipment technical field, especially relates to a kind of device of automatic quick-replaceable automatic vehicle battery.
Background technology
The power supply mode that in current warehouse logistics industry, automatic vehicle adopts is generally three kinds: be " contact energy transferring ", " non-contact type energy transmission " and " automatic charging " pattern respectively, for employing " automatic charging " pattern, during its charging, automatic vehicle can not work, just can put into operation after having needed charging, to charge length consuming time, cause the work efficiency of automatic vehicle very low and charging unit is changed and difficult in maintenance.

Detailed description of the invention
Below in conjunction with the accompanying drawing in the utility model embodiment, be clearly and completely described the technical scheme in the utility model embodiment, obviously, described embodiment is only the utility model part embodiment, instead of whole embodiments.Based on the embodiment in the utility model, those of ordinary skill in the art are not paying the every other embodiment obtained under creative work prerequisite, all belong to the scope of the utility model protection.
The device of automatic quick-replaceable automatic vehicle battery shown in Fig. 1-6, it comprises:
Horizontally suspend the guide rail 9 be fixedly installed;
Be arranged at the traveling gear 8 along guide rail 9 movement on guide rail 9; This traveling gear 8 comprises the walker 5 be positioned at below guide rail 9, be installed on walker 5 from the wheel group 23 that both sides are engaged with guide rail 9, be arranged at for driving the motor 11 of wheel group 23 on walker 5, and be arranged at the guiding wheels 24 for coordinating guide rail 9 to lead on walker 5;
Be fixedly installed on the lift system 7 of traveling gear 8 lower end; This lift system 7 is comprised and to be fixedly installed on below walker 5 and the adapter plate 21 of end face level by four suspension rods 20, vertically to be fixedly installed in the middle part of adapter plate 21 and piston rod is positioned at the first electric cylinder 12 of below, middle part to be connected with the piston rod end of the first electric cylinder 12 and to be positioned at the base plate 15 below adapter plate 21, and the pilot bar 19 that two vertical settings and lower end are fixedly connected with base plate 15; Described adapter plate 21 is arranged the orienting sleeve 22 coordinated with pilot bar 19; And
Be fixedly installed on the Shen Cha mechanism 6 of traveling gear 8 lower end; This Shen Cha mechanism 6 comprises two pieces and to be symmetricly set on base plate 15 and can along base plate 15 plane in opposite directions or the slide plate 17 of opposing movement, four are symmetricly set in two slide plate 17 lower ends and near the L shape hook 16 at slide plate 17 two ends place, and two symmetries be fixedly installed on base plate 15 drives two slide plates 17 near or the second electric cylinder 13 of being separated;
The horizontal sides of the hook 16 on described slide plate 17 is parallel with the moving direction of slide plate 17, and on two slide plates 17 horizontal sides of hook 16 towards opposing.
In the present embodiment, described guide rail 9 is provided with the drag chain 10 for motor 11, first electric cylinder 12 and the power supply of the second electric cylinder 13.The upper end of described guide rail 9 arranges multiple U-shaped suspension hook 29, is convenient to the installation of guide rail 9.
In the present embodiment, described slide plate 17 is positioned on base plate 15, described base plate 15 offers with the corresponding position of hook 16 and stretches out downwards and waist shaped hole for leading for hook 16, obvious slide plate 17 also realizes arranging with the relative movement of adapter plate 21 by the mechanism such as slide rail, dovetail furrow.The two ends of described guide rail 9 are provided with limiting stopper 28, protect traveling gear 8 not getaway 9 when guaranteeing that traveling gear 8 controls malfunctioning.Described wheel group 23 comprises four wheels, and one of them is driving wheel, and to be driven with motor 11 by imput shaft 25 and be connected, other three is flower wheel, is connected with walker 5 by driven shaft 26.The piston rod of described first electric cylinder 12 is hinged by hinged seat 18 and base plate 15, avoids the first electric cylinder 12 to cause resistance to increase because of vibration equipment, or causes piston rod and be out of shape.Described guiding wheels 24 comprise four track adjusting wheels, are arranged at the two ends of walker 5 along guide rail 9 movement.
The algorithm that the utility model changes automatic vehicle battery is as follows:
(1) automatic vehicle electricity parks station 1 lower than the automatic vehicle entered below this device under the scheduling of Upper system of automatic vehicle during setting value, and charging unit 4 carries out temporary power to parking dolly;
(2) lift system 7 action Shi Shencha mechanism 6 drops to target location;
(3) the second electric cylinder 13 action of Shen Cha mechanism 6 both sides drives hook 16 to stretch out (opposing movement) and hooks battery corner;
(4) lift system 7 rises to initial position;
(5) traveling gear 8 moves to along guide rail 9 and takes out assigned address above battery placement station 2;
(6) battery is positioned over and takes out battery placement station 2 by lift system 7 action (decline);
(7) the second electric cylinder 13 action of Shen Cha mechanism 6 both sides drives hook 16 to retract (moving in opposite directions);
(8) step (4) is repeated;
(9) traveling gear 8 moves to Full Charge Capacity battery along guide rail 9 and places assigned address above station 3;
(10) step (2), (3), (4) are repeated;
(11) traveling gear 8 moves to automatic vehicle along guide rail 9 and parks assigned address above station 1;
(12) battery is positioned in automatic vehicle by lift system 7 action (decline);
(13) repetition step (7), (4) complete the automatic quick-replaceable of battery.
